Upon declaring for the 2007 NBA draft, Horford was selected third overall by the Atlanta Hawks. His rookie contract was a significant financial milestone, earning him just over $10 million over the course of three years. This contract provided the foundation for his financial stability, but it was his decision to re-sign with the Hawks in 2013 that truly altered the trajectory of his earnings. Instead of testing the free agent market and potentially chasing a bigger payday elsewhere, Horford agreed to a five-year, $113 million extension. At the time, this move was viewed by many as a loyalty bonus to a franchise that had become his home, but it also demonstrated his focus on building long-term security rather than maximizing short-term gains.
